Space under Mooppanar flyover to get synthetic flower gardens, strolling paths and higher lighting

After a number of dry spells and repeated complaints about wilted vegetation, the underpass under the Mooppanar flyover close to Chamiers Road is ready for a makeover. The Greater Chennai Corporation (GCC) plans to switch the light vertical backyard with ornamental flower buildings for decorative show.

According to a Corporation official, the undertaking, estimated at almost ₹1.25 crore, includes not solely ornamentation but additionally the rejuvenation of the house beneath the flyover. This consists of establishing a bolstered concrete underpass with strategy roads, drainage strains, and retaining partitions to enhance automobile motion below the bridge.

The plan options ornamental flower installations with crimson rose, crimson hibiscus, and golden sunflower motifs on the flyover, and white jasmine, orange marigold, and crimson rose motifs inside the underpass part.

Meanwhile, related consideration to the greenery below different flyovers, reminiscent of these on T.T.Ok. Road and in Royapettah, is but to be given. Sundara Vadivel, an everyday commuter alongside T.T.Ok Road stated the vertical backyard arrange below the flyover has been in poor situation for a number of days and has been uncared for. “The identical arrange below the flyover near Vani Mahal in T.Nagar was eliminated a number of months in the past. The identical synthetic vegetation and rejuvenation have to be put up below these bridges quickly to curb waste dumping, open defecation and from being occupied by tipplers after darkish,” he stated.

An official in GCC acknowledged that the flyovers at Doveton, Kalaivanar, Peters Road, Conronsmith Road, Rangarajapuram, and Vyasarpadi would all get a makeover, however solely subsequent yr. Plans embody new greenery, higher lighting powered by photo voltaic power, and CCTV cameras for security. People can sit up for strolling paths, decorative vegetation, benches, and even play areas or open gyms. The funds for the Kalaivanar flyover is ₹3.74 crore, Doveton ₹3.25 crore, and Rangarajapuram railway overbridge ₹2.53 crore, he stated.
